Adds an `xla_client.heap_profile(client)` API which produces a gzip-compressed profile.proto protocol buffer containing an on-device heap profile, suitable for visualization via the pprof tool (https://github.com/google/pprof). The heap profile includes buffers and executables allocated by JAX. PiperOrigin-RevId: 316138726 Change-Id: I1b263f8033c6fc07466a362ff3d6f65a55334def
